Lucy Charles' sub 5 bike and 3:05 run feels like it can be enough to put her in contention with Ryf at Kona. Lucy is only 24 and her run will just get better, but with that swim she does not need to run sub 2:55. I think if she runs close to 3 hours in Kona with a men's front pack equivalent swim (she swam 47.5 and Josh did 46.5), she can just win the race by T2. Also keep in mind last year she did Lanza + Frankfurt+Kona all at full throttle. I wonder what her schedule is this year. Hopefully she is more fresh for Kona.

I would think a 6:42 hike is a quick recovery in that he basically did a hard swim-bike and a long walk. No pounding, just some dehyration. Good on him for finishing. I just checked Hoffman's KPR and he has 3845 points with no points from 70.3. If he wins a 70.3 or better yet, gets some good points at a 70.3 regional championship he ends up with enough points to qualify for Kona and does not need to do another Ironman, so the the long walk may pan out to be a good strategic move.
